hi guys, im relatively new to the aquarium scene (one previous only guppy and some plecos tank) i recently saw a picture of an Ornate Birchir on this forum, and thought it looked really cool (i think it was called Snr. Puff or something). ive been doing loads of research on it for about a week and am seriously considering buying one, just wondering if its a good idea since im not that experienced.
thanks
 
As long as you have a big enough tank, they're pretty easy to keep. They don't have any kind of difficult needs, but they are predators and are one of the species of poly that are notorious for eating smaller polys. Also, sometimes they can be aggressive towards other ornates, so it's usually recommended to keep only one ornate. They can be kept with most other fish of similar size, as long as the other fish are not overly aggressive.

They'll eat pretty much anything, pellets are usually recommended as a staple diet, however if you want to offer fresher foods such as tilapia fillets or shrimp, those are great too. They don't need great water quality, just keep up your water changes and they'll be fine. Ultimately, they're a pretty hardy and good-looking fish, I'd definitely recommend them.
